John Edgar

Birth19 Nov 1780 - Mouswald, Dumfriesshire, Scotland
Death1857 - Collin, Torthorwald, Dumfriesshire, Scotland
MotherAnn Hawkins
FatherJoseph Edgar

Born in Mouswald, Dumfriesshire, Scotland on 19 Nov 1780 to Joseph Edgar and Ann Hawkins. John Edgar married Isabella Aitcheson and had 14 children. He passed away on 1857 in Collin, Torthorwald, Dumfriesshire, Scotland.
